▼I’d like to see Finland one day, and TIL (Today I Learned, for those of you just joining us) about a place that will definitely be on my list of places to see: SIBELIUS Park, which was named for the composer on his 80th birthday in 1945 and has a magnificent kinetic monument to him that is essentially a giant wind chime.
